Purpose and Importance

The rogues gallery served as an early tool for systematic criminal identification before modern forensic techniques like fingerprinting. By maintaining visual records of known offenders, police could more easily identify repeat criminals, track criminal activity, and standardize documentation. Each entry typically included the individual’s name, aliases, physical description, and known criminal activities, laying the groundwork for modern criminal databases.

Modern and Figurative Usage

Today, the term has broadened beyond law enforcement. It can refer to any collection of unsavoury, notorious, or undesirable people or things, often used humorously or ironically. For example, a film with poor direction, acting, and cinematography might be described as a "rogues' gallery of bad cinema," or a company with problematic employees could be called a "rogues' gallery of developers". In popular culture, especially in comics and superhero media, a "rogues gallery" refers to a hero’s recurring villains, such as Spider-Man’s or Daredevil’s collection of adversaries.
